Q: Is 38,975 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 38,975 is not a prime number.

Why is 38,975 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 38975 can be evenly divided by 1 5 25 1,559 7,795 and 38,975, with no remainder.

Since 38,975 cannot be divided by just 1 and 38,975, it is not a prime number.
